Robyn Brown recently made her feelings toward her former sister wives clear, and they were far from positive. For the unversed, Robyn does not share a good relationship with any of Kody Brown's former wives, Christine, Janelle, or Meri Brown, and it was further cemented in 'Sister Wives' Season 20. As Kody's only remaining wife, Robyn recently met with Meri and Janelle, but things didn't go as planned. Robyn admitted she "doesn’t really endorse fakeness," and unsurprisingly, not a single word was exchanged between the former partners.

In the latest episode of 'Sister Wives' Season 20, the former partners met at Coyote Pass to finalize their property dispute. A sneak peek shared by Us Weekly on Friday, November 21, shows the four standing together in total silence, sharing an extremely tense moment. Kody and Robyn met with the realtor, looked over the final documents, and left "without speaking a word" to Janelle or Meri. Talking about the situation, Robyn said, "I don't really endorse fakeness. And, like, 'Okay, let's pretend everything's okay,' when it's not."

The realtor opened the meeting by saying, "We're ready to go. I've got some stuff just to go over with you guys, just as far as making sure everything’s spelled right and all the deeds are printed out and ready to go." While Kody and Robyn quietly reviewed the paperwork, Meri kept her distance. Janelle was the only one actively participating, explaining that her portion of the sale would go toward investing in her new flower farm in North Carolina, as per Prime Timer.

Janelle asked the realtor to confirm that the contract matches what they previously agreed on, ensuring everyone's name is on the correct plot, a concern rooted in Kody’s earlier attempt to divide the property unevenly. Once the realtor assured her everything was accurate, Janelle was relieved that the deal was "finally done." After the realtor left, Kody and Robyn immediately departed as well, creating an uncomfortable silence between Meri and Janelle. In her confessional, Janelle said, "I think Robyn felt like she was going to be persecuted or attacked or something. And I'm like, 'No, we could be adults here.' But whatever."

As the two women walked back to their cars, they admitted the entire interaction was "super awkward" and far more uncomfortable than they expected. Later in her confessional, Robyn said she can't pretend everything w fine with Janelle and Meri, and Kody adds that his wife hates "girl games." While Season 20 revealed the tense process of selling the land, the Browns had actually sold the 14-acre Coyote Pass property months earlier, in April 2025, for roughly $1.5 million.
